Abstract

The invention discloses a plateau high-altitude motor reversing power switching device, and belongs to the field of motors. The plateau high-altitude motor reversing power switching device comprises a control box, a motor box, switching mechanisms, a power shaft, an output shaft, a rotating disc and a transmission mechanism, a switching cavity is formed in the control box, the motor box is arranged in the switching cavity and can move left and right, sliding cavities are formed in the upper side and the lower side of the switching cavity in a communicating mode, and the switching mechanisms are arranged in the upper sliding cavity and the lower sliding cavity. The switching mechanism is used for controlling the motor box to move left and right, a power motor is fixedly arranged in the motor box, the power shaft is in power connection with the right end of the power motor, a transmission cavity located on the right side of the switching cavity is formed in the control box, and the right end face of the power shaft extends into the transmission cavity. According to the scheme, the meshing mode of the transmission straight gear can be changed, so the positive and reverse rotating states of the output shaft re controlled, a reversing mode of a traditional brush motor is changed, and the service life of the electric brush of the positive and negative rotation motor is prolonged.

technical field [0001] The invention relates to the field of electric motors, and more specifically, relates to a commutation power switching device for high-altitude and high-altitude electric motors. Background technique [0002] When ordinary engines are used directly on plateaus or high altitudes, due to the large difference in air pressure, there are serious problems in power loss and service life. [0003] The motor operates at high altitude, due to the low air pressure and poor heat dissipation conditions, that is, the loss will increase and the operating efficiency will decrease, and the altitude is not good for the power commutation of the motor, which will affect the life and performance of the carbon brush material, and more seriously It will cause the motor to burn out in a short time.
